About Chen Yang
Chen Yang is a scholar working on Surgery, Epidemiology, Hematology, Molecular Biology and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 86 papers that have together received 928 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Orthopaedic implants and arthroplasty (17 papers), Total Knee Arthroplasty Outcomes (15 papers), Knee injuries and reconstruction techniques (7 papers), Hip and Femur Fractures (7 papers), Lower Extremity Biomechanics and Pathologies (7 papers), Hip disorders and treatments (6 papers), Bone fractures and treatments (6 papers) and Bone and Joint Diseases (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Urology (79 citations), Surgery (455 citations), Biological Psychiatry (24 citations), Rheumatology (122 citations) and Epidemiology (266 citations). Chen Yang has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Guihao Zhang, Jie Zhao, Jiawei Chen, Peng Wu, Jiarong Zeng, Weina Huang, Xin Qi, Jianguo Liu, Junpeng Wang and Shuqiang Li. Their work appears in journals such as The Knee, BMC Musculoskeletal Disorders, International Orthopaedics, Frontiers in Cellular and Infection Microbiology and Oxidative Medicine and Cellular Longevity.
